Can You Build a Blackstone Griddle into an Outdoor Kitchen?

The short answer is yes, you can build a Blackstone griddle into an outdoor kitchen. However, just because it is technically possible doesn't necessarily mean it's the best option for your needs. In this article, we'll explore some of the reasons why you might want to think twice before building a Blackstone griddle into your outdoor kitchen, as well as an alternative option to consider.

Reasons Not to Build a Blackstone Griddle into an Outdoor Kitchen:

  1. Lack of Durability - While Blackstone griddles are built to last, they may not be the best option for a permanent installation. The outdoor environment can be tough on equipment, and a freestanding griddle may not hold up as well as a built-in model.

  2. Limited Design Options - Because Blackstone griddles are freestanding units, they may not fit seamlessly into your outdoor kitchen design. You'll need to plan carefully to ensure that the griddle is both functional and aesthetically pleasing.

  3. Limited Cooking Space - While Blackstone griddles are available in a range of sizes, they may not offer the same level of cooking space as a built-in model. If you're planning to entertain large groups of people or cook elaborate meals, you may find yourself wishing for more room to work with.

  4. Limited Features - While Blackstone griddles offer excellent value for their price point, they may not come with the same level of features as a built-in model. For example, a built-in griddle may offer more advanced temperature control or a built-in rotisserie.

Griddles in Outdoor Kitchens FAQs:

Question: Can I build a built-in griddle into my outdoor kitchen if I already have a gas line?
Answer: Yes, if you already have a gas line installed, it's relatively easy to build a built-in griddle into your outdoor kitchen. Just make sure you have enough space and ventilation to accommodate the griddle.

Question: Can I use a built-in griddle as a primary cooking surface in my outdoor kitchen?
Answer: Yes, many people choose to use a built-in griddle as their primary cooking surface in their outdoor kitchen. Just make sure you choose a model that is large enough to accommodate your needs.

Question: Can I build a built-in griddle into a wooden structure?
Answer: It is not recommended to build a built-in griddle into a wooden structure due to fire hazards. It is recommended to use non-combustible materials, such as stainless steel or stone.

Question: Can a built-in griddle be converted to a different fuel source?
Answer: Some built-in griddles are designed to be compatible with multiple fuel sources, such as propane and natural gas. However, it is important to check the manufacturer's specifications before attempting to convert a griddle to a different fuel source.

Question: What size built-in griddle should I choose for my outdoor kitchen?
Answer: The size of the built-in griddle you choose will depend on your cooking needs and the size of your outdoor kitchen. It's recommended to choose a griddle that is at least 24 inches wide for basic cooking needs, and larger if you plan to entertain or cook more elaborate meals.

Question: What kind of maintenance is required for a built-in griddle?
Answer: Regular cleaning is essential for maintaining the performance and longevity of your built-in griddle. It's recommended to clean the griddle plate after each use and periodically clean the interior and exterior of the griddle as well. Additionally, it's important to check the gas lines and connections periodically to ensure they are in good working condition.
